cross sparc64 chapter 5 glibc tls required error with 20050930 version of book

Bryan Kadzban bryan at
Sun Oct 2 05:43:21 PDT 2005

Frans Verstegen wrote:
> Fiddling with the configure-fragment (running manually) the
> compile/link aborts because the crt1.o cannot be found:
>   bash-2.05b# sparc64-unknown-linux-gnu-gcc -m64 -mcpu=ultrasparc 
>   -mtune=ultrasparc -o conftest.bin   -g -O2 conftest.s
>   /home/lfs/cross-tools/bin/../lib/gcc/sparc64-unknown-linux-gnu
>   /4.0.2/../../../../sparc64-unknown-linux-gnu/bin/ld: crt1.o: No 
>   such file: No such file or directory
>   collect2: ld returned 1 exit status

Is the same error in your top-level config.log file?  That's what that
log file is there for -- to log errors like this.  Whether it is or not,
someone more familiar with cross compiling will probably have to step in
-- I'm just trying to narrow down the problem.

I have no idea if this is normal or not, either.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 256 bytes
Desc: OpenPGP digital signature
URL: <>

More information about the lfs-dev mailing list